Re: Electronics Board Wiring Concern

It's more of a performance concern, the less load there is in the wiring that provides power to the RC, the better. Sharing the RC power wires with the motor power wiring leads to excessive voltage drop at the RC and could cause it to reset, I believe.

So, run separate big fat wires from the Power Distribution Block to each of the load centers (MaxiBlock, ATC panel, Victor returns, etc)
